New Computer Won't Accept Password...Help? (See below).

Asked by Jacinda1 (8points) March 22nd, 2012

I got a new computer and did all the set-up. I am the only user. It asked me for a password to use to lock the computer when it closes/shuts down/hibernates. I chose a password, entered it, came up with password hints…even typed and re-typed it as I thought of a secure one. I am sure of the password, basically.

I shut it down to go run an errand…came back and it says “wrong
password”. I have checked caps, everything. No deal. It is telling me it is wrong. I know it is not. I have done this set-up before
on other computers—no problems. I typed it in carefully and it is still saying it’s not right.

I had problems with my other computer, hence this new one.l am having to run the old one on an ethernet cable and was running it
as I configured the new one. Would that have interfered? I was doing that because my old one was refusing to recognize the wireless and I needed it until I set up the new one. I am typing on the old (ethernet) connected one. The new one was picking up wireless fine.

I promise I checked and re-checked the passwords…now I am locked out of my computer…completely. It says that the to only way to set up a new password is to use a floppy or a USB…I have no idea what either one is.

I am not locked out of my account…I am locked out of even getting into Windows…if you know of a simple way for me to get in, will you please let me know?
